No actual goods transactions; fraudulent purchase and sale contracts; forged customs declarations, logistics documents, and input invoices; export operations under another company’s name; customs clearance based on purchased documents; third-party shipment arrangements; and the use of shell companies to cycle through customs declarations. Common practices among cross-border and foreign trade enterprises include: customs clearance in a different location; discrepancies between the flow of goods and the flow of funds; and breaks in the document chain. ✅ Consequences: Classified as fraudulently obtaining export tax rebates, resulting in substantial fines, retroactive tax audits covering 3–5 years, and, in severe cases, direct criminal liability.
Deliberately concealing income, underreporting deductible expenses, and artificially inflating the carryforward tax credit balance; issuing fraudulent input invoices, making abnormal tax deductions, and showing severe discrepancies between input and output invoices; switching from a small-scale taxpayer to a general taxpayer, hoarding large quantities of invoices over a short period, and rushing to apply for carryforward tax credit refunds. ✅ Consequences: Forced recovery of tax refunds, credit rating downgraded to Grade D, restrictions on invoice issuance, and disruption of normal business operations.
Failing to meet industry qualification requirements and forcibly applying tax rebate policies intended for small and micro enterprises, high-tech enterprises, and industrial parks; splitting up companies and distributing revenue across multiple entities to artificially meet tax rebate thresholds; registering shell companies in other locations—with no actual business premises or employee social security contributions—solely for the purpose of cashing out tax rebates.
Recording transactions without supporting documents, falsifying costs, and arbitrarily inflating expenses; concealing profits, fabricating losses, and submitting tax refund applications in violation of regulations; abnormal loss of contact with upstream and downstream businesses, as well as unusual fluctuations in purchases and sales, leading to the risk of tax refund denial due to being implicated in a joint audit.

✔ Incomplete import/export documentation; logistics records do not match ✔ Suspicious sources of input invoices; frequent changes in partner companies ✔ Long-term, large-scale VAT carryovers; persistent losses despite continued operations ✔ Reliance on third-party tax refund agencies; low-cost financial and tax outsourcing ✔ Frequent transfers from business to personal accounts; capital inflows; chaotic related-party transactions
If you meet even one of these criteria, you will be placed on the tax authorities’ watchlist and could face an on-site audit at any time.
